Battery Life
The Jbl Tune 230nc provides approximately 5 hours of playback on a single charge, with an additional 15 hours from the charging case. The Jabra Elite 3 offers slightly better battery life, with up to 7 hours of continuous use and a total of 28 hours with the charging case. Longer battery life can be a decisive factor for users who prioritize all-day usage.
Features and Connectivity
The Jbl Tune 230nc includes active noise cancellation (ANC), which is a significant feature at its price point. It also supports Bluetooth 5.2 for stable connectivity. The Jabra Elite 3 does not have ANC but offers good passive noise isolation and supports Bluetooth 5.2 as well. Both models feature touch controls and IP55 water resistance, making them suitable for workouts and outdoor activities.
